Other eats on the menu include barbecue sausage, fries and takoyaki-savory octopus balls fried to a crisp on the outside but fluffy on the inside. The dark meat of the chicken is lined in a soft batter and seasoned with one of five options: pepper salt, spicy, garlic, curry or basil. Chen says since the shop opened, it has received more than 100 orders daily for the Asian-style fried chicken. It’s thanks in part to one non-tea item: popcorn chicken.
